Notice of Board Vacancy

The Williamston School District is seeking applications for the current vacant position on the Williamston Community Schools Board of Education.  An individual will be appointed to fill the vacant position until the November 4, 2014, election.

 

Interested persons must submit a letter expressing interest in the board position and their qualifications for the position to the district office no later than 3:00 o’clock p.m. on June 26, 2013.  Submissions may be either by U.S.P.S., hand delivery, or email to WCSBoard@gowcs.net addressed to:  Mrs. Marci Scott, President, Williamston Board of Education, 418 Highland Street, Williamston, MI 48895.

 

Eligibility Requirements:  To be eligible, a person must be a qualified school elector.  This means that the applicant must be a registered voter in the school district.  An applicant must be at least 18 years of age; a citizen of the U.S.; a resident of the State of Michigan for at least 30 days; and a resident of the school district.

 

Following review of the submitted materials, the board will schedule interviews with selected candidates.  Board interviews will be held at the Williamston Middle School Multi-Purpose Room either at the regular meeting on Monday, July 15, 2013, or at another designated special meeting in July.  All candidates for the board vacancy may not be interviewed. These interviews will be held during a public meeting.  If you have any questions concerning the role of the board of education and the responsibilities of a board member, please contact Mrs. Narda Murphy, Superintendent of Schools, at 517-655-4361 or any of the current Board members.
